<p>Fix 'to'-attribute requirements: All content elements which are signed using OpenPGP need
|
|
|
|
|
that attribute to prevent Surreptitious Forward Attacks. The &crypt; element does not require
|
|
|
|
|
one, as the intented recipient is established by the encryption itself. The XEP had the
|
|
|
|
|
requirements for &sign; and &crypt; mixed up.</p>
